Course structure

• Introduction to Ceramic Materials and Tools
• Hand-Building Techniques: Pinching, Coiling, and Slab Construction
• Wheel-Throwing Fundamentals and Advanced Techniques
• Surface Decoration: Glazing, Underglazing, and Texturing
• Kiln Operation and Firing Processes
• Sculptural Design and Conceptual Development
• Advanced Ceramic Sculpture: Large-Scale and Mixed Media
• Studio Safety and Best Practices
• Art History and Contemporary Ceramic Art Trends
• Portfolio Development and Professional Practices

Career path

Ceramic Artist

Create unique ceramic artworks, combining traditional techniques with modern design. High demand in galleries and private collections.

Studio Potter

Produce functional and decorative pottery, often working in independent studios or teaching workshops.

Ceramic Designer

Design ceramic products for mass production, collaborating with manufacturers to meet market trends.

Art Educator

Teach ceramic sculpture techniques in schools, colleges, or community centers, fostering creativity and skill development.
